Distillation of logic-qubit entanglement assisted with cross-Kerr nonlinearity

Abstract

Logic-qubit entanglement has attracted much attention in both quantum communication and quantum computation. Here, we present an efficient protocol to distill the logic-qubit entanglement with the help of cross-Kerr nonlinearity. This protocol not only can purify the logic bit-flip error and logic phase-flip error, but also can correct the physical bit-flip error completely. We use cross-Kerr nonlinearity to construct quantum nondemolition detectors. Our distillation protocol for logic-qubit entanglement may be useful for the practical applications in quantum information, especially in long-distance quantum communication.
